TRANSPORT INSURANCE CO. v. EMPLOYERS CASUALTY CO.

No. 17667.

470 S.W.2d 757 (1971)

TRANSPORT INSURANCE COMPANY, Appellant, v. EMPLOYERS CASUALTY COMPANY, Appellee.

Court of Civil Appeals of Texas, Dallas.

Rehearing Denied September 17, 1971.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Jack Pew, Jr., Jackson, Walker, Winstead, Cantwell & Miller, Dallas, for appellant.

James H. Holmes, III, Burford, Ryburn & Ford, Dallas, for appellee.


CLAUDE WILLIAMS, Chief Justice.

Employers Casualty Company issued its liability policy to Prior Products, Inc., covering its vehicles, with liability limits of $100,000/$300,000. Transport Insurance Company issued its liability policy to Hunsaker Truck Lease, Inc., with liability limits of $300,000/$500,000. Both policies contained identical "Other Insurance" clauses providing for a pro rata division of losses.
